Latest Patents

Yuhui Du holds a patent for a phosphorus-free corrosion and scale inhibitor used in circulating cooling water of central air conditioning. This invention includes a unique formulation that comprises tourmaline, a green corrosion and scale inhibitor, and zinc salt. The specific contents of these components are carefully calculated to optimize performance. The patent also details a method for preparing this innovative inhibitor, which effectively addresses copper corrosion in cooling systems.
